PETALING JAYA: Eleven Malaysians will be chasing for big money when they compete in the inaugural Bowling World Open, which begins in Tokyo on Wednesday.
The major-rated competition is the richest event – with a total of ¥48mil (RM1.5mil) up for grabs – on the World Bowling Tour this season.
